Transaction 95de2b63b909c5e143d666911f31692ab954d32d40c3213dc6eee0c883062c6a
1 Input
1 Output
-
95de2b63b909c5e143d666911f31692ab954d32d40c3213dc6eee0c883062c6a:0
- value
- 1836233
- script pubkey
- OP_0 OP_PUSHBYTES_20 8687b703953c6124564897b4bc34a56343a639a8
- address
- bc1qs6rmwqu483sjg4jgj76tcd99vdp6vwdgf7vhty